The drama between Clare Crawley and Matt James seems to be far from over.  

Article continues below advertisement

After reports that James had reunited with ex Rachael Kirkconnell, but was also speaking to another woman beforehand, the 40-year-old Bachelorette seemingly took a swipe at the season 25 Bachelor.

"Clare Crawley tried to warn bachelor nation about Matt James don’t forget! Lol," one fan tweeted, which Crawley retweeted with shrug and smug-faced emojis.

James was originally due to appear on Crawley’s season of The Bachelorette, which was postponed due to the coronavirus pandemic, only to later be announced as Bachelor Nation’s first Black Bachelor.

Article continues below advertisement

"If you are doing interviews and creating Cameo accounts before you are even on my season... you are in it for the wrong reasons... #dontwasteyourtime," Crawley tweeted in April 2020, which seemed to be a dig a James, who was doing press at the time.

Article continues below advertisement
Article continues below advertisement
Article continues below advertisement

However, Crawley later clarified that the tweet was actually not targeted specifically at James. "It was about MULTIPLE men and a general thought I was having while we sit here in a real life crisis where someone’s (everyone’s) time + sincerity hold so much weight and value," she explained.

James finished his season by asking Kirkconnell to be his girlfriend, but called it quits after old social media posts and images of Kirkconnell at an antebellum-themed formal surfaced online as the season was airing. 

Article continues below advertisement

"They’re not officially back together," an insider told Us Weekly of the former flames’ NYC reunion. “She reached out to Matt to see if he would be open to meeting with her. They’ve been communicating this whole time and she’s been updating him on how she’s been educating herself.”

Article continues below advertisement

Last week, a woman named Grace Amerling claimed that James was speaking to her days before he asked Kirkconnell to come to New York, PEOPLE reported. 

Article continues below advertisement

"Rachael is very emotional right now because she was very hopeful that things were going to work out. She’s still trying to process this," another source spilled, while a third insider said James was not looking for a romantic relationship with his ex after calling it quits.

Article continues below advertisement

Kirkconnell feels that James broke her trust, according to one insider, but "understood why he publicly said he couldn't see a future with her because of what she had done and the responsibility he felt as the first Black Bachelor, and she supported him."

Article continues below advertisement

It seems as though Kirkconnell has been getting a lot of mixed messages from her ex-man. "He's been telling her he loves her and has never felt this way for anyone else before. After the scandal, he said it would take time for them to work on themselves separately, but he wanted to get back together one day and still pictured a life for them together, with a family and everything," said an insider

Article continues below advertisement
Article continues below advertisement

Kirkconnell previously confessed that James was the love of her life, while he admitted on the After The Final Rose special that Kirkconnell needs to learn and grow from her mistakes by herself "and that's why we can't be in a relationship."

Article continues below advertisement
Source: Rachael Kirkconnell/ Instagram

Kirkconnell also issued an apology for her past "racist" and "offensive" actions at the time and has promised to use her platform to share antiracism resources.
